Output 77ab4bedb30e919109dc6fb5c9d3e164a465811a4b4dcc2e7eaa6384c41e6e74:2

value
659616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82eca2f6d19113efdde5e48f8b4bcc6ac92322d7 OP_EQUAL
address
3DdHFHAHDotdfbQxeKZsYoDWpyWN24YZVC
transaction
77ab4bedb30e919109dc6fb5c9d3e164a465811a4b4dcc2e7eaa6384c41e6e74
spent
true